The following GPU lockup occurs consistently soon after starting Dillo (an
fltk-based lightweight web browser) compiled without Cairo support.

I am happy to provide any additional information or diagnose further as
directed.

"ATI Radeon 7500 QW (AGP/PCI)" (ChipID = 0x5157)

Linux cube 4.1.6-gentoo #2 Sat Aug 29 23:38:46 AEST 2015 ppc 7400, altivec
supported PowerMac5,1 GNU/Linux

mesa-11.0.0_rc1
